BIOL 683 - Tropical Ecology

Units: 3
A survey of the unmanaged and managed tropical terrestrial ecosystem and the biotic (living) and abiotic (non-living) factors that affect tropical ecosystem structure and function. Emphasis will be on the community dynamics and biogeochemical cycling of tropical ecosystems, and how these processes are affected by land-use and land-cover change. This course will be taught together with BIOL 383  by the same instructor. Enrollment restricted to students in the Biological Sciences graduate program who have not received credit for BIOL 383 . Enrollment Requirements: Enrollment requirements: BIOL 212  and BIOL 354 .
